A security vulnerability has been identified in Zutty, an X terminal emulator included in Ubuntu 22.04 LTS. Discovered by Carter Sande, the flaw allows attackers to execute arbitrary commands by exploiting improper input handling on DECRQSS. Users of Ubuntu and its derivatives are advised to apply patches to mitigate this risk.
